What does your day look like with Partner?


PVESC is looking for an anesthesia-focused RVT. Your primary case load will be neurology procedures (MRIs, surgeries, and CSF taps). You will be part of an experiences team consisting of 2-3 other RVTs, 2-3 veterinary assistants, and 2 neurologists. When not engaged with anesthesia procedures, involvement with inpatient care for neurologic patients or anesthesia procedures in other departments (primary ER) may be encouraged.


You will coordinate with specialists to create drug protocols and anesthetic plans. You will work with a diverse patient population that will benefit from your advanced skills and talents. Our hospital also offers a collaborate atmosphere with support from multiple other specialties: emergency, critical care, internal medicine, surgery, cardiology, and oncology.


This role is ideal for the licensed veterinary technician who is focused on stellar anesthetic patient care, working with doctors who rely on your anesthetic knowledge to make informed decisions, and using advanced equipment to promote a safe/stress-free environment. Our psychologically safe workplace provides the framework for you to be successful in this role. Our VTS in anesthesia and analgesia ensures you attain and achieve any additional training you need. 


This role is a four 10-hour shift role that ideally participates in optional weekend on-call. Utilizing your skills, this role also supports the training of safe anesthesia practices for your peers in the hospital.
